show-tls shows mixed TLS 1.3 and TLS 1.2 ciphers. The ciphersuites
are only valid in tls-cipher or tls-ciphersuites. So this confusing and
not really helpful.
This patch modifies show-tls to show separate lists for TLS 1.2 and
TLS 1.3.
